Announce Drilling set to commence on Ontario Joint Venture with Kennecott VANCOUVER, BRITISH COLUMBIA--Canabrava Diamond Corporation (CNB-CDNX) and Paramount Ventures & Finance Inc. (PVF-CDNX) announce that the winter exploration program on their Ontario Joint Venture with Kennecott Canada Exploration Inc. has commenced and is progressing well. The Ontario Joint Venture includes Canabrava's 100% owned Whitefish Lake Project, as well as the KAP and Rocky Island Lake Projects which are owned 50% by Canabrava and 50% by Paramount. These projects are located northeast of Wawa, Ontario and include more than 200,000 hectares of staked and leased land. A high-resolution helicopter magnetic/EM survey was flown over a priority area on the Whitefish Lake Project in early January, and a number of new high interest anomalies have been identified. Kennecott geophysicists are in the process of modelling these anomalies in preparation for follow-up ground geophysics and drill testing. Field crews mobilized in mid-January and have established a camp in the central part of the Whitefish Lake Property. A ground access trail has been constructed to the camp and all of the required equipment has been mobilized to site. Line cutting crews have established grids over high interest targets on the Whitefish Lake and Kap South Properties, and four ground geophysical teams are presently conducting magnetic and EM surveys over these anomalies. Only the best targets based on a combination the geophysical and indicator mineral results will be drill tested during this first program. Drilling is set to commence on February 14th and should be completed by mid to late March. Additional exploration on the KAP and Rocky Island Lake Properties is being planned for the spring and summer field seasons. Kennecott has the option to earn a 60% interest in the Ontario Joint Venture by spending $25 million within seven years, or by advancing any one of the Projects to a production decision, whichever occurs first. Kennecott, as operator, must spend $1.5 million on exploration before December 10, 2000.
